6+ New iOS Beta 3 Features: What's Changed?


6+ New iOS Beta 3 Features: What's Changed?

The third pre-release version of Apple’s mobile operating system offers developers and early adopters a preview of enhancements and modifications slated for the general public release. This iterative build allows for the identification and resolution of potential issues, ensuring a more stable and refined user experience upon wider deployment. Key aspects often include alterations to the user interface, performance improvements, bug fixes, and the introduction of nascent functionalities.

Such releases play a crucial role in the software development lifecycle. They enable Apple to gather feedback from a broad user base under diverse usage conditions, which is invaluable for identifying edge cases and optimizing performance across various device models. Historically, these intermediate builds have proven essential in mitigating potential large-scale problems that might arise post-official launch, thereby safeguarding the company’s reputation and user satisfaction. The availability to developers enables third-party applications to be thoroughly tested and updated, so as to be ready for new features.

The following sections will detail some of the observed changes, improvements, and potential impacts associated with this specific development iteration, covering areas such as user interface adjustments, core application updates, and overall system performance refinements.

1. Refined haptic feedback

The incorporation of refined haptic feedback within this iteration signifies an incremental improvement to the tactile interactions users experience when engaging with their devices. It represents a tangible element within the overall package of system enhancements.

  • Granular Vibration Control

    The new software introduces more precise control over the intensity and duration of haptic feedback. This enables developers to create more subtle and nuanced tactile responses that are contextually relevant to the specific actions being performed within an application. For instance, a gentle pulse could confirm a successful authentication, while a stronger vibration might indicate an error. This level of granularity was less prevalent in previous versions.

  • System-Wide Consistency

    Another facet involves ensuring a consistent haptic experience across different applications and system interfaces. This prevents jarring transitions or unexpected vibration patterns that can detract from the overall user experience. The goal is to create a unified and predictable tactile language that reinforces user actions and provides valuable feedback without being intrusive.

  • Customization Options

    The beta includes expanded options for users to customize the haptic feedback settings according to their preferences. This allows individuals to fine-tune the intensity and patterns of vibrations to suit their individual needs and sensitivities. Customization can improve accessibility for users with specific sensory requirements, and allows individuals to minimize distractions.

  • Hardware Optimization

    Refined haptic feedback requires concurrent optimization with the device’s physical haptic engine. This involves fine-tuning the software algorithms to effectively leverage the hardware capabilities, ensuring optimal performance and responsiveness. The beta focuses on efficiency to prevent excessive battery drain when vibration is used.

In conclusion, the enhancements to haptic feedback, as observed in this iOS beta, are indicative of Apple’s continuing commitment to refining the user interface and enhancing the overall sensory experience. These subtle but significant changes contribute to a more intuitive and responsive operating system, aiming at improved satisfaction and efficiency.

2. Optimized battery management

Within the context of pre-release iterations of mobile operating systems, improvements to power consumption are a frequent area of focus. Optimizing battery management is a significant component within a new software version, aiming to improve the longevity of device use between charges. The adjustments can vary, impacting background processes, display behavior, network activity, and processor utilization. These changes are intended to minimize unnecessary energy expenditure, allowing for extended operation without compromising performance.

The effects of battery optimization efforts can manifest in several ways. For instance, adjustments to background app refresh intervals reduce the frequency with which apps retrieve new data when not in active use. This reduces network activity and processing overhead, conserving power. Adaptive brightness algorithms, based on ambient light conditions, automatically regulate screen luminosity to reduce power consumption, while maintaining screen clarity. Improvements to thermal management can also prevent the device from overheating, which can degrade battery performance over time. Real-world examples include increased video playback time, longer standby duration, and improved performance during resource-intensive tasks, such as gaming or video editing, as the power usage is more controlled.

Effective battery management in this pre-release form not only benefits end-users by extending device usability, but also provides valuable data for the software development team. Monitoring power consumption patterns allows the team to identify and address potential areas of inefficiency before the general public release. This process, coupled with user feedback on battery performance, facilitates continuous refinement and optimization, ensuring that the final release offers a reliable and efficient user experience. The connection is thus critical, acting as both a user-facing enhancement and a development tool for enhanced performance.

3. Enhanced privacy controls

The refinement of privacy safeguards represents a significant component within the iterative development of the mobile operating system. Modifications to existing functionalities, along with the introduction of new controls, provide users with greater oversight and management of their personal data.

  • App Tracking Transparency Updates

    Further adjustments to the App Tracking Transparency framework allow users to exert finer-grained control over which applications can request permission to track their activity across other companies’ apps and websites. This includes refined notification settings and more detailed explanations of tracking practices within the permission request prompts. The implication of these updates is a reduced ability for applications to gather user data without explicit consent, promoting enhanced user autonomy.

  • Location Data Minimization

    Efforts to minimize the amount of location data collected and stored are evident in the updated location service settings. New options may include the ability to grant applications approximate location access instead of precise coordinates, providing a general vicinity without compromising specific location details. This functionality reduces the potential for misuse of location data while still enabling location-based services to function effectively.

  • Microphone and Camera Usage Indicators

    Expanded visual indicators provide users with clearer notification when an application is actively accessing the device’s microphone or camera. These indicators, typically displayed as small icons in the status bar, offer real-time transparency into application behavior and help users identify potential unauthorized access. The inclusion of expanded access logs, detailing how frequently apps request access to camera or microphone hardware, enables a clearer understanding of app behavior, thus giving more control back to users.

  • Data Sharing Control

    Within the settings, enhanced tools may be present that provide a centralized location to review and manage data sharing agreements with various applications and services. This could include the ability to revoke permissions, modify data sharing preferences, and access detailed reports on the types of data being shared. The consolidation of these controls aims to simplify the process of managing privacy settings and empower users to make informed decisions about their data.

The multifaceted approach to enhanced privacy observed in this iteration demonstrates an emphasis on user empowerment and data protection. These modifications collectively aim to provide greater transparency, control, and awareness, contributing to a more secure and privacy-conscious operating system environment. This, in turn, represents a core commitment to user data protection within the evolution of the operating system.

4. Improved app stability

The inclusion of improved app stability as a component of the development stage reflects a core objective in software refinement. This element addresses the propensity for applications to experience unexpected crashes, freezes, or other malfunctions during operation. Such instability can stem from various sources, including coding errors, memory leaks, or conflicts with system resources. Consequently, efforts to bolster app stability are integral to enhancing the overall user experience.

In this particular build, improvements in app stability are achieved through a multi-pronged approach. This may include the implementation of more rigorous error handling routines, enhanced memory management techniques, and updated compatibility layers to address potential conflicts with third-party applications. As an example, enhanced error handling within the operating system can catch and address common software exceptions before they manifest as app crashes. Memory management optimizations prevent applications from consuming excessive system resources, mitigating the risk of performance degradation or instability. The effects of these enhancements are demonstrated through increased reliability of existing applications, resulting in fewer instances of unexpected termination and enhanced responsiveness during normal operation. Furthermore, improved app stability enables developers to more effectively debug their applications, improving the lifecycle process of software updates.

Improved app stability is not merely a desirable attribute but a fundamental requirement for a successful mobile operating system. By actively addressing sources of application instability, this build contributes to a more reliable and consistent user experience. Addressing this issue in pre-release iterations allows for comprehensive testing and validation, ensuring that any remaining issues are identified and resolved before the broader release. This meticulous approach ensures that the final release meets a high standard of operational integrity, minimizing disruptions to users and enhancing the overall perceived value of the platform.The commitment to improvement through such means is key to the continuous process of enhancement across future updates.

5. Updated widget designs

Within the scope of changes to the mobile operating system, revised widget aesthetics and functionalities are a notable element. These modifications represent an effort to refine the at-a-glance information delivery and interactive capabilities offered through widgets. As a component, redesigned widgets contribute to the overall user experience, offering potentially enhanced convenience and efficiency in accessing frequently used information and functionalities without launching full applications. This alteration may result in improved user interaction, but its efficacy requires thorough evaluation within the broader ecosystem.

The impact of redesigned widgets extends beyond mere visual changes. The update may introduce improvements in data presentation, allowing for more information to be conveyed within the same screen real estate. Interactive elements within widgets could permit users to perform actions, such as controlling music playback or managing calendar events, directly from the home screen or Today View. These changes are typically intended to streamline workflows and reduce the number of steps required to accomplish common tasks. For example, a weather widget may now display more detailed forecast information, or a news widget may provide a larger preview of articles. These changes could provide a more comprehensive and actionable overview to users. Further real-world examples may include enhancements to fitness tracking widgets, smart home controls, or email previews, providing users with direct access to key functions and information without the need to open respective applications.

In conclusion, updated widget designs, as part of the release, represent an attempt to enhance the user interface and improve accessibility to core features. These design modifications aim at improving convenience and speed of access to information. Evaluation of user adoption and feedback are crucial to ascertain whether these revisions provide tangible benefits and align with the requirements of end-users. The effectiveness of such revisions is a critical factor in gauging the success of the new design elements.

6. Fixed connectivity issues

The resolution of connectivity problems constitutes a significant aspect of operating system development. In pre-release iterations, such as the development stage being referenced, addressing these issues is paramount to ensure consistent and reliable communication capabilities across a range of networks and devices. Connectivity encompasses several areas, including cellular data, Wi-Fi, Bluetooth, and other wireless protocols. Unresolved problems in these areas can lead to disruptions in service, hindering user experience and limiting the functionality of applications reliant on network access. Therefore, efforts to identify and rectify these issues are critical components of the ongoing development and refinement process.

The implementation of fixes for connectivity problems involves a systematic approach to identifying root causes, implementing corrective measures, and validating the effectiveness of those measures. This process may include analyzing network logs, debugging system processes, and conducting extensive testing under various network conditions. Examples of specific fixes may include addressing problems with Wi-Fi authentication, improving Bluetooth pairing reliability, optimizing cellular data throughput, or resolving conflicts with virtual private network (VPN) configurations. Successful implementation of these fixes enhances overall system stability and provides a more seamless and dependable user experience. Real-world examples of improved connectivity could include faster web browsing speeds, more reliable Bluetooth audio streaming, and the ability to maintain stable connections during video calls or online gaming sessions.

Ultimately, fixing connectivity issues in this pre-release iteration contributes to a more robust and reliable operating system. These improvements enhance user satisfaction and confidence in the platform. The emphasis on resolving connectivity challenges reflects a commitment to providing a seamless and dependable user experience, minimizing potential disruptions and ensuring that users can effectively utilize the full range of communication features offered by their devices. Addressing these matters is crucial in the software development life cycle to ensure a stable release.

Frequently Asked Questions

This section addresses common inquiries regarding specific functionalities and operational characteristics of the aforementioned development build. Information presented herein aims to provide clarity on areas of user interest and potential concern.

Question 1: What is the intended purpose of this development stage?

The purpose is to provide developers and select users with early access to the operating system to facilitate testing and feedback. This allows for the identification and resolution of potential issues before the general public release, leading to a more refined and stable final product.

Question 2: Is installation on primary devices recommended?

Installation on primary devices is generally discouraged due to the inherent instability associated with pre-release software. Unexpected crashes, data loss, and incompatibility with certain applications may occur. It is advised that installation be limited to secondary devices used for testing purposes.

Question 3: How does one report issues or provide feedback?

Feedback and issue reporting are typically facilitated through Apple’s Feedback Assistant application. This tool allows users to submit detailed reports, including system logs and diagnostic information, directly to Apple’s engineering team for analysis and resolution.

Question 4: What are the key differences between this stage and previous releases?

The key differences typically involve incremental refinements to existing features, bug fixes, and performance optimizations. Specific changes may include alterations to the user interface, enhanced security protocols, or improved compatibility with third-party applications. A comprehensive list of changes is generally provided in the release notes.

Question 5: Will data be automatically migrated from previous versions?

While data migration is generally supported, it is strongly recommended to create a backup before installing the pre-release. This precaution safeguards against potential data loss or corruption during the installation process. Backup solutions include iCloud and local backups to a computer.

Question 6: Is it possible to revert to a prior operating system version?

Downgrading to a previous operating system version is possible, but it is a complex process that may require specialized tools and technical knowledge. It is essential to follow Apple’s recommended procedures and exercise caution to avoid data loss or device damage.

This FAQ section provides a baseline understanding of several aspects. However, users are encouraged to consult official Apple documentation and support resources for comprehensive and up-to-date information.

The following section will delve into troubleshooting techniques that can be employed to address common problems.

Tips Regarding the Third Iteration of Apple’s Mobile Operating System Pre-Release

This section offers guidance on optimizing the experience and mitigating potential issues associated with this particular development build. Adherence to these suggestions can contribute to a more stable and productive testing environment.

Tip 1: Prioritize Regular Backups. Data loss is a potential risk with pre-release software. Implement a consistent backup strategy, utilizing iCloud or local backups, to safeguard against unforeseen circumstances. Conduct backups prior to installation and periodically thereafter.

Tip 2: Monitor System Resource Usage. Pre-release software may exhibit inefficiencies in memory management or processing power utilization. Employ system monitoring tools to track CPU usage, memory consumption, and battery drain. This facilitates the identification of potential bottlenecks and resource leaks.

Tip 3: Adhere to the Compatibility Guidelines. Verify the compatibility of critical applications and services before deploying the pre-release. Incompatibility can lead to malfunctions and data corruption. Consult developer documentation and community forums for compatibility information.

Tip 4: Utilize the Feedback Assistant Effectively. When reporting issues, provide detailed and comprehensive information. Include step-by-step instructions to reproduce the problem, system logs, and relevant screenshots. This enhances the likelihood of accurate diagnosis and timely resolution.

Tip 5: Exercise Caution When Installing Third-Party Software. Only install applications from trusted sources. Pre-release operating systems may be more vulnerable to security exploits. Verify the authenticity and integrity of software before installation.

Tip 6: Regularly Check for Updates. Development builds are often updated frequently to address identified issues and introduce new features. Consistently check for and install available updates to benefit from the latest bug fixes and performance enhancements.

These guidelines are intended to enhance the stability and usability of the operating system during the development phase. Diligence and adherence to these recommendations are crucial to a productive experience.

The concluding section will summarize key considerations and provide closing remarks on the pre-release phase.

Conclusion

The foregoing analysis has detailed notable aspects of the development phase. Examination of refined haptic feedback, optimized battery management, enhanced privacy controls, improved app stability, updated widget designs, and connectivity issue resolutions, underscores the range of modifications incorporated within this particular iteration. These features represent incremental improvements designed to enhance the user experience and system reliability prior to widespread deployment. The importance of continued testing and user feedback during this stage is fundamental in ensuring the stability and effectiveness of the final release.

The trajectory of iterative refinement illustrates a commitment to continuous improvement and responsiveness to user input. The value lies in the rigorous assessment and modification undertaken throughout the pre-release timeline. The collective focus is to ensure a robust, secure, and user-centric mobile platform, highlighting the long-term significance of these intermediate development stages in achieving an enhanced operational system.